The time period of the two pendulums is 1.44 s and 0.36 s respectively. Calculate the ratio of their lengths.


Open in App
Solution

Step 1:Given data

Let the two pendulums be A and B

Time period of pendulum A is T1=1.44sec

Time period of pendulum B is T2=0.36sec

Step 2: Relationship between time period and length

We know that time period is directly proportional to the square root of the length

TLwere,T=timeperiodofapendulumL=effectivelength

Hence it can be written as,

T2=LwhereT=timeperiodofapendulumL=effectivelength

Step 3:Calculating corresponding ratio of their length

L1L2=T1T2L1L2=1.44sec0.36secL1L2=14436L1L2=41Takingsquareonbothsides,L1L2)2=412L1L2=161=16:1

Hence, the ratio of their length is 16 :1.
